DR. ROBERT BELL

Robert H. Bell serves as Assistant Superintendent/Senior Vice President at Pasadena City College, where he oversees noncredit, community education, off campus programs and operations, and community advancement. Additionally, he oversees the Adult Education Block Grant (AEBG) and the growth of adult education. He has also served as Senior Vice President, Academic and Student Affairs and Vice President, Student and Learning Services at the college.
Prior to coming to Pasadena City College, he served as the Senior Vice President for the Louisiana Community and Technical College System, Vice President of Student Services at Chaffey College in Rancho Cucamonga, California and Vice President of Student Services at South Puget Sound Community College in Olympia, Washington. He has previously held leadership positions in student services at Cerritos College, The University of Southern California, Harvey Mudd College and UCLA.
Dr. Bell holds a B.A. and M.A. from the University of Redlands, Redlands, California, and an Ed.D. in Educational Administration and Counseling Psychology from the University of the Pacific, Stockton, California. Dr. Bell has completed numerous workshops on leadership and administration, including the Harvard University Program for Leadership Development Program.
Dr. Bell is active in the community and works closely with local school districts, community groups and municipalities. He lives in Pasadena with his wife Victoria and two sons.
